Started in the rain & finished in the rain after 2.5 hours completing the final part of the 2 acre failed crop area. No real surprises today, just the usual high count of buttons - 57.

Spectacle Buckle
2 Tudor Belt Mounts (Rose & Fluer-de-Lis)
Worcester WWI Shoulder/Lapel Badge
Circa 1910 Cricketers Buckle
Victorian Police Button
2 Livery Buttons
Tiny Bead (eyes only)

Now that all the ploughed options are done, we need to find a grass field with short enough grass:icon_scratch:
